CONAHCYT Postgraduate Scholarships: Who Qualifies and What You Get
Journalists in Mexico can apply for monthly stipends and tuition coverage to support their specialized master's degrees.
This scholarship program provides financial assistance to journalists who are looking to advance their professional education through specialized master's degree programs.
Who it's for
This scheme is specifically designed for journalists who are currently pursuing or planning to enter specialized master's degree programs. It is intended to support those in the journalism field who wish to deepen their expertise through advanced academic study.
What you get
If you are selected for this support, you will receive a monthly stipend to help cover your ongoing living expenses while you study. Additionally, the scholarship includes coverage for your tuition, helping to reduce the overall financial burden of completing a specialized master's degree.
What it costs you
There is no direct monetary fee mentioned for the application itself, but the process requires a significant investment of your personal time. You will need to navigate a highly competitive application process that requires careful preparation of your academic and professional credentials to be successful.
The catch to know
The most important thing to keep in mind is that this program maintains very high academic requirements. Applicants must meet strict academic standards to be considered, meaning the selection process is quite rigorous and not guaranteed for every applicant.
